Name: Fujiwara no Mokou
Gender: Female
Appearance: Living forever ain't as good as you think it is, y'know.
Personality: Mokou is by no means sociable; due to her immortality, she's seen many people die as time passes, and thus removes herself willingly from human society in order to avoid the everlasting pain of parting. Her age also makes her much wiser than she appears to be, though it may not always seem as such at first. She IS still human at heart, though, and is fairly altruistic in spite of what she has lived through thus far. To those who do get her to open up a bit more, Mokou is a rather blunt person, though nowhere near as hotheaded as her control of fire would USUALLY implicate. While content with her life in Gensokyo, if something piques her interest, she won't hesitate to pursue it. When she's committed, though, she goes ALL OUT. The only other thing that might cause such a reaction is killing Kaguya, because, well... Grudges. Even that's sorta gone stale, though.
Having lived for so long, Mokou has also looped around from sane to insane and back again. Nothing really fazes her any more, save for being dragged to the Outside World thanks to a certain meddling student, but... Well, those are a different story. She also understands that life is still something important and the impact of taking a life, though that doesn't mean that she much cares for her own.
Dying still hurts, though. She tries to avoid it.
Species: Human (Immortal)
Abilities: Other than the standard of 'flight' that all Gensokyo residents have, Mokou also has access to a plethora of spellcards at her disposal. She can also shoot and control fire at will. Oh, and she's immortal in regards to the fact that no matter how many times she's killed, she'll always come back to life. Mokou also has a tendency to theme her attacks around the motif of a phoenix and can (and will occasionally) self-immolate herself to bring her body back to peak condition. Her body is still that of a human's, though, so pain is still pain, and death is still death (and that hurts a ton).
Skills: Other than knowing the Bamboo Forest of the Lost like the back of her hand, Mokou can cook fairly well. Whether or not that expands past 'drying foods out' or 'making yakitori' remains to be seen.
Brief Backstory: Once a human, Mokou drank the Hourai Elixir whilst seeking revenge against Kaguya (yes, THAT Kaguya) for humiliating her father as a child. Immortality ensued. Ever since then, Mokou's been lingering on as an undying existence, eventually finding her way to Gensokyo. Looping through complete insanity before running back to sanity and repeating that cycle a few times over (along with beating the everloving crap out of Kaguya and vice versa a few times over). Following the events of Imperishable Night (aka the 'fake moon incident'), Mokou's gone back to her daily life of lounging about...
Well, assuming that incidents don't directly involve her or anything. There was that one time that she went out into modern-day Japan, which was... Something. Didn't learn much from the experience, though.
Thankful that the merchant had become occupied with trying to sell her wares to the other people milling about, Mamoru let out a sigh of relief as he began to read over the notice in a bit more detail. It seemed straightforward enough--kill bears, bring back the corpses, obtain money. That meant, though, that if he was going to take on the job, he'd be needing to hire someone to bring them all back. Logically, that could be handled afterwards, but for now...

Right, taking on bears alone was a death sentence. Though they are often solitary creatures, a bear is still a bear. And then there were the fringe cases where bears could control qi...

It wasn't as if it hadn't happened before, to be fair; there were a few cases in the past where animals had some instinctual reaction to qi or something, and the resulting messes were never pretty. But hey, at least they usually went for a lot of money.
...
Granted, that money usually went to the families of those who died, but it was better than the families and the men dying, right?

Before he could begin walking around to the usual hunters, though, Mamoru paused for a moment as two women (one of which being the merchant who was attempting to have him buy her goods) offering their services. The swordsman gave them a quick once-over before shrugging and nodding his head.

"I don't think there's any problem with that, you two. Scouts are always a bit more troublesome to come by in this region because everyone's so focused on strengthening their bodies for their work, so your help would be appreciated; as for you, miss merchant... Remember that the bears are a bit more dangerous this time of year. I'd recommend you stay alert if you wish to come along; the more the merrier, correct?"

With that said, Mamoru moved off to the side before beginning to converse with a few of the regulars. After all, if there was anyone with experience with this sort of thing, it was them. Even if they decided they had better things to do for the day, their advice might still help in the long run.
